The Signs A Pipe May Need Relining

If you’re not certain whether or not your pipes need relining, here are some signs to look out for:

  • Water leakage
  • Unpleasant odors emanating from your drains
  • Gurgling noises coming from your drains
  • Slow drainage or clogs

Can Collapsed Pipes Be Relined?

We cannot reline pipes that have collapsed. If you have a pipe that has collapsed, you will need replacement of the pipe. If you’re not certain what the damage is to your pipe you can have us come out and do an inspection for you.

What Is The Difference Between Pipe Relining And Pipe Replacement?

Pipe relining creates a new pipe inside of the existing one, while replacement is a process that breaks the old pipe and replaces it by a new one.

Relining pipes is usually more non-invasive and could be a more affordable option than pipe replacement. Talk to a professional regarding your particular needs to figure out which solution will be most suitable for you.

Does Pipe Relining Affect Pipe Flow?

There is generally no change in pipe flow as a result of pipe relining. Relining pipes is often a way to increase how much water flows through the pipe since it creates an entirely new and smooth surface for water to flow through.

How Long Has Pipe Relining Been Used For?

Pipe relining has been utilised for quite a while, the first instance of its use dating back to 1854. But it was only in the early 2000’s when it started to become more popular.

Nowadays, pipe relining technology is used all over the globe as a successful solution to fix damaged or leaking pipes without the need to remove them and replace them entirely. There are many different types of pipe relining services that can be employed dependent on the kind of pipe used and the severity of the damage.

For example, there is spot pipe relining Glenalta, which is utilised for leaks of a small size, in addition to structural pipe liner, which is used for more serious damage. Whatever type of pipe relining technique is employed it’s the purpose is always the same: fixing the pipe, without needing to replace it completely.

This alternative that does not require excavation can reduce time and cost and it’s also a more eco-friendly option than relocating the pipe.
